http://www.victoriana.com/death-mask-mary-queen-of-scots-k.html WebNov 29, 2024 · Death masks are fascinating but slightly haunting relics from an age before photos. Until cameras rendered them redundant, it was common for notable people to have metal, wax or plaster applied to their face when they had died, creating a “death mask”. The motivation behind the masks morphed with time.
